Lincoln vs Tripoli Climate & Distance Between

Lebanon flag
  • The distance between Lincoln, New Zealand and Tripoli, Lebanon is approximately 16,183 km or 10,056 mi.
  • To reach Lincoln in this distance one would set out from Tripoli bearing 118.7°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ach Lincoln bearing 89.5° or E .
  • Lincoln has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Tripoli has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a).
  • Lincoln is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ome whereas Tripoli is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
  • The mean temperature is 8.5 °C (15.2°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.1 °C (3.8°F) less in Lincoln.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 281.2 mm (11.1 in) less which is equivalent to 281.2 l/m² (6.9 US gal/ft²) or 2,812,000 l/ha (300,621 US gal/ac) less. About 2/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9.8° lower in Lincoln than in Tripoli.
